The closure of tourist climbing at the Ijen Crater only lasted a few days. Not even a week has passed, the East Java KSDA Center has reopened this weekend.
Precisely on Saturday, January 6 2024, Ijen Crater can be climbed by travelers. However, there are new requirements that must be met.
“The following are the latest requirements for tourist visitors to the Ijen Crater Nature Tourism Park (TWA) conservation area which will be implemented starting January 6 2024,” said the East Java Natural Resources Conservation Center (BKSDA), quoted Thursday (4/1/2024) from its official Instagram.
